Welsh Pony Rescue & Rehoming Charitable Trust
Rescue, rehabilitation & rehoming of abandoned & unwanted equines to alleviate suffering. In particular we rescue colts & stallions from Gelligaer & Cefn Golau Commons & promote breeding controls. We operate throughout Wales, but mainly South Wales.

Annual Returns
As filed with the Charity Commission for England and Wales. Most recent filing covers the financial year ending 2023.
One or more years show a significant change in income (over ±100%) compared with the prior year. This usually reflects a merger, transfer of activities, restated accounts, or a one-off legacy — not necessarily a real change in operating scale. See the methodology for context.
| Financial Year | Income | Expenditure | Charitable Spending | Net Assets | Reserves | Staff |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2023 | £45,166 | £109,380 | 0 / 20 | |||
| 2022 | £122,856 | £78,176 | 0 / 38 | |||
| 2021 | £122,074 | £119,943 | 0 / 37 | |||
| 2020 | £56,272 | £48,415 | 0 / 40 | |||
| 2019 | £48,097 | £52,349 | 0 / 35 |
Staff column shows: Employees / Volunteers

When was Welsh Pony Rescue & Rehoming Charitable Trust registered as a charity?
Welsh Pony Rescue & Rehoming Charitable Trust was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 10 January 2017 as charity number 1171060. It has been registered for 9 years.
Who runs Welsh Pony Rescue & Rehoming Charitable Trust?
Welsh Pony Rescue & Rehoming Charitable Trust is governed by a board of 3 trustees. The chair of trustees is ANN KEATING. Trustees are legally responsible for the charity's governance and are listed in full on its profile.
